Static electricity occurs when electrons build up on an object, giving it a charge. Opposite charges attract, while like charges repel. When a build up of electrons is discharged, it can flow quickly and cause phenomena like lightning or static cling on clothes in the dryer. Grounding provides a path for excess electrons to safely reach the earth or ground.
